Qlean Dataset Introduces a Japanese Shrine Image Dataset for Vision and Multimodal AI

Visual Bank Inc. (Minato-ku, Tokyo; CEO: Saneyuki Nagai), through its subsidiary amanaimages Inc., has launched a new dataset under its AI training data solution, Qlean Dataset: the Japanese Shrine Image Dataset.

The dataset is intended for AI research and development, including image recognition, image classification, and multimodal applications.
It consists of photographs taken at Shinto shrines across Japan, capturing real outdoor environments. The images cover key architectural and spatial elements such as shrine buildings, torii gates, approach paths, and shrine grounds. Shrines in a variety of settings—from urban areas to forested and mountainous regions—are included, reflecting the diversity of Japan’s cultural landscapes and environmental conditions.
The dataset also spans different seasons and weather conditions. By capturing shrine architecture together with its surrounding natural environment, the images represent the spatial characteristics unique to Japanese shrines, where built structures and nature are closely connected.
Each image includes metadata related to the location and subject matter. This allows the dataset to be used not only as visual reference material, but as structured data for analyzing spatial composition and environmental context. Focusing on a specific cultural subject, the dataset supports training and evaluation of AI models that require Japanese cultural and environmental visual elements, which are often underrepresented in general-purpose outdoor image datasets.

The Japanese Shrine Image Dataset is part of Qlean Dataset’s original lineup, AI Data Recipe, and is cleared for both research and commercial AI use. Through datasets grounded in cultural and social contexts, Visual Bank supports practical development and evaluation in real-world AI applications.

Use Case Examples

Research Applications 

  • Image Recognition Research on Outdoor Cultural Spaces
    The dataset can be used to evaluate recognition and classification models for structures and spatial elements in outdoor environments, using images that include shrine buildings, torii gates, and shrine grounds.

  • Evaluation of Visual Representation Learning in Foundation and Generative Models
    Real-world outdoor images of Japanese shrines can be used in the training and evaluation of generative AI and multimodal foundation models to analyze visual representations and spatial understanding.

 Industrial Applications 

  • Image Analysis AI for Tourism and Regional Information Services
    The dataset can serve as training data for AI products that recognize and classify outdoor facilities, including shrines, in tourism guidance and regional information services.

  • Training Data for Generative AI and Multimodal Foundation Models
    The images can be used for training or fine-tuning image generation models and vision-language models, providing real-world visual data that includes outdoor environments and cultural landscapes.

 Educational and Other Practical Applications 

  • Supporting Cultural and Landscape Understanding in Education
    In educational contexts, the dataset can be used as visual material focused on Japanese shrines to support learning and research related to regional culture and landscape understanding.
